Handover Note — Large-Deal Discount Policy

To the incoming director: current policy allows account teams up to 12% discretionary discount on deals above the enterprise threshold; anything beyond requires my sign-off, now yours. In practice, exceptions cluster around the Halverson and Pineward accounts — scrutinize those renewals closely. I have documented each approved exception in the deals register with rationale. Finance reviews the register quarterly. The planned evolution of this policy is outlined below.

internal memo for kawip-hadug: Headcount on the Wenwyn team goes from 7 to 140 by the end of January. Gross margin on Wenwyn came in at 20 percent against a plan of 15 percent.

Hi Veltro team,

Quick heads-up: our Pingwell service got noisy again, so we've dropped log sampling to 5% on the shared integration tier. Security-relevant events (auth failures, scope changes) are still logged at 100%, so your review coverage isn't affected. If you need a temporary full-capture window, just ping us. For pulling the sampled stream yourself, authenticate with the token below.

session JWT of yawep-yawep = eyJhbGciOiJIUzI1NiIsInR5cCI6IkpXVCJ9.eyJzdWIiOiI3pWF3_In0.aXYsHiog

Action item (Postmortem PM-Birchfield-12): The clinic appointment reminder job at Saltmere Health silently stalled when the send window overlapped the nightly schedule rebuild. On-call must add an alert on queue age and shorten the batch window so reminders cannot lag past the appointment lead time. Verify the new values against the worst observed backlog before deploying. The revised tuning constants are as follows.

constants for hahip-hafog:
WEIGHTS = {
    "feniel": 55,
    "kasox": 667,
}

## Changelog — Perlane API 2.8: batching defaults

The GraphQL resolver layer now enables dataloader batching by default, eliminating the N+1 query pattern on nested fields. Query depth limits are unchanged; batch windows are capped to prevent amplification. Security reviewers should note that per-request query counts drop sharply, which affects rate-limit telemetry baselines. The defaults introduced in this release are as follows.

deployment values, yadug-bawif:
[framir]
team = pelox
access_code = ac_a38ab2
owner = tamion.julael
host = framir.tolvaqlabs.test
port = 11211
peer = tammir.zemvargrid.local
salt = 2215ef03
pin = 1541